Jonathan Houseman Davis is an American singer, songwriter, and musician, best known as the lead vocalist and frontman of the nu metal band Korn.
Korn, which he co-founded in Bakersfield, California, in 1993, is considered a pioneering act of the nu metal genre. Davis's vocals are a trademark of the band's sound, alternating from an angry tone to a high-pitched voice, and switching from sounding atmospheric to aggressively screaming. His lyrics are often personal and passionate.
In addition to his work with Korn, Davis has also pursued a solo career. He is a multi-instrumentalist who can play instruments like the guitar, drums, bagpipes, piano, violin, and clarinet. He also performs and mixes electronic music tracks as his alter ego, JDevil.
